摘 要:为了探讨左旋肉碱对环磷酰胺所致的小鼠少弱精症的治疗作用,将成年昆明小鼠30只,随机分成对照组(CG)、模型组(MG)和治疗组(TG)。按照60mg/kg给模型组和治疗组小鼠腹腔注射环磷酰胺,60mg/kg给对照组小鼠腹腔注射生理盐水,每天1次,连续5d。第6天开始按100mg/kg给治疗组小鼠灌胃左旋肉碱,按100mg/kg给空白对照组和模型组灌胃生理盐水,每天1次,持续25d。随后处死小鼠,进行小鼠精子的采集,对精子进行计数,活力检测;对睾丸进行固定包埋、切片和HE染色。结果显示,对照组、模型组和治疗组精子密度分别为(1.90±0.43)×10^9/L,(1.58±0.32)×10^9/L和(2.62±0.41)×10^9/L;精子活率分别为(65.46±14.98)%,(58.68±3.13)%和(74.66±1.04)%;精子畸形率分别为(58.35±1.25)%,(78.44±0.38)%和(51.624±0.11)%。治疗组精子密度显著高于模型组(P〈0.05),治疗组的精子活率要高于模型组,畸形率要低于模型组。因此,对小鼠进行腹腔注射环磷酰胺可使小鼠精子的密度、活率降低,畸形率增高,左旋肉碱治疗后,可使小鼠的精子密度有明显的增高,同时在一定程度上可以提高精子活率,降低精子畸形率。睾丸切片HE染色显示,左旋肉碱能够对环磷酰胺所致的睾丸损伤有一定的保护作用。To explore the therapeutic effect of L-carnitine(LC) on the male mouse with cyclophos- phamide-induced asthenospermia. Male Kunming mouse (n = 30) were randomly divided into the control group(CG),model group(MG),treatment group(TG). Control group was given intraper- itoneal injection of physiological saline solution(60 mg/kg) once a day for 5 days,and the model group and treatment group were given the intraperitoneal injection of cyclophosphamide(60 mg/kg) once a day for 5 days. On the 6th day treatment group was treated via gastric gavage of L-carnitine (100 mg/kg) once a day for 25 days consecutively,and the model group was given isopyknic physi- ological saline solution. Then all the mouse were killed for the detection of sperm motility, sperm count and sperm morphology. In control group, model group and treatment group, the sperm count was (1.90±0.43) X 10^9/L, (1. 58±0. 32) x10^9/L, and(2. 62±0.41) x 10^9/L respectively,and motility rate was(65.46±14.98) % ,(58.68±3.13)% and(74.66±1.04) % respectively. The percentage of sperm deformity was(58.35±1.25)%, (78.44±0.38)% and(51.62±0.11) %,respectively. The sperm count of model group was significantly lower than treatment group. The motilityrate in treatment group was higher than in model group (P〈0.05),and the percentage of sperm deformity in treatment was lower than in model group. The intraperitoneal injection of cyclophos- phamide can decrease sperm count and motility rate, and increase the percentage of sperm deformi- ty. L-carnitine can improve sperm count significantly, and increase sperm motility rate and decrease sperm deformity to a certain extent. The results of HE staining showed that L-carnitine could pro- tect the testis injury induced by cyclophosphamide.
